Zookeeper 伪分布式部署
Zookeeper 可以通过配置不同的配置文件启动
部署环境:CentOS 6.7
Zookeeper 路径: /opt/htools/zookeeper-3.4.6
操作步骤:
1 复制三份zoo.cfg 配置文件,依次命名为 zoo1.cfg zoo2.cfg zoo3.cfg, 之后分别编辑其中的内容
cp zoo.cfg zoo1.cfg
cp zoo.cfg zoo2.cfg
cp zoo.cfg zoo3.cfg
(1)zoo1.cfg
initLimit=10
syncLimit=5
dataDir=/usr/local/zookeeper-3.4.6/
server.1=iZ2ze1tefvghtcexi8dnhwZ:20881:30881
server.2=iZ2ze1tefvghtcexi8dnhwZ:20882:30882
server.3=iZ2ze1tefvghtcexi8dnhwZ:20883:30883
(2)zoo2.cfg
initLimit=10
syncLimit=5
dataDir=/usr/local/zookeeper-3.4.6/
server.1=iZ2ze1tefvghtcexi8dnhwZ:20881:30881
server.2=iZ2ze1tefvghtcexi8dnhwZ:20882:30882
server.3=iZ2ze1tefvghtcexi8dnhwZ:20883:30883
(3)zoo3.cfg
initLimit=10
syncLimit=5
dataDir=/usr/local/zookeeper-3.4.6/
server.1=iZ2ze1tefvghtcexi8dnhwZ:20881:30881
server.2=iZ2ze1tefvghtcexi8dnhwZ:20882:30882
server.3=iZ2ze1tefvghtcexi8dnhwZ:20883:30883
2 参考三份配置,分别建立数据目录和日志目录
cd /usr/local/zookeeper-3.4.6
mkdir 1.data 2.data 3.data
mkdir 1.logs 2.logs 3.logs
3 分别在每个数据目录新建myid 文件
vim /usr/local/zookeeper-3.4.6/1.data/myid 输入 1 保存退出
vim /usr/local/zookeeper-3.4.6/2.data/myid 输入 2 保存退出
vim /usr/local/zookeeper-3.4.6/3.data/myid 输入 3 保存退出
4 启动服务以及查看运行状态命令
(1)启动命令
/opt/htools/zookeeper-3.4.6/bin/zkServer.sh start /opt/htools/zookeeper-3.4.6/conf/zoo1.cfg
/opt/htools/zookeeper-3.4.6/bin/zkServer.sh start /opt/htools/zookeeper-3.4.6/conf/zoo2.cfg
/opt/htools/zookeeper-3.4.6/bin/zkServer.sh start /opt/htools/zookeeper-3.4.6/conf/zoo3.cfg
(2)查看状态命令
/opt/htools/zookeeper-3.4.6/bin/zkServer.sh status /opt/htools/zookeeper-3.4.6/conf/zoo1.cfg
/opt/htools/zookeeper-3.4.6/bin/zkServer.sh status /opt/htools/zookeeper-3.4.6/conf/zoo2.cfg
/opt/htools/zookeeper-3.4.6/bin/zkServer.sh status /opt/htools/zookeeper-3.4.6/conf/zoo3.cfg
最新文章
- CSharpGL(25)一个用raycast实现体渲染VolumeRender的例子
- 在 CentOS7 上安装 MySQL5.7
- Java连接SqlServer2008数据库(转)
- 交换机做Channel-Group
- PHP自学链接收藏
- .net 中生成二维码的组件
- Vim编辑器-批量注释与反注释
- QThread与其他线程间相互通信
- OTG中的ID脚风波释疑
- QT学习 之 文本文件读写
- Java: 类继承中 super关键字
- Linux下 Vim(Vi)编辑器的使用
- mssql sqlserver SQL 位运算举例权限应用
- Android灯光系统_编写HAL_lights.c【转】
- 【Linux优化】Linux安装之后的优化
- Linux,IDS入侵防御系统
- gentoo raid1
- Linux 禁止root 用户登录启用sudo
- mybatis按姓名或手机号搜索
- 【javascript基础】JS计算字符串所占字节数